Personal Details and Career Highlights

To give you a clearer picture of the man behind those unforgettable characters, here are some basic facts about Gene Hackman. These bits of information, you see, help paint a picture of the journey he took from his beginnings to becoming a respected figure in the movie world. It’s always interesting to connect the person with the art they create, and his life story is, in some respects, just as compelling as some of his films.

DetailInformation
Full NameEugene Allen Hackman
BornJanuary 30, 1930
BirthplaceSan Bernardino, California, USA
OccupationActor (Retired), Novelist
Active Years1956–2004 (Acting)
AwardsTwo Academy Awards, Four Golden Globe Awards, One BAFTA Award, One Screen Actors Guild Award

Gene Hackman Movies That Changed the Game

Some of Gene Hackman's films aren't just good; they're considered landmarks in cinema, the kind of movies that people still study and talk about years later. "The French Connection," for instance, is one of those gritty, unforgettable pictures where he really showed his incredible skill. His portrayal of Popeye Doyle was so intense and believable, it practically leaped off the screen. That performance, in a way, set a new bar for how a tough, determined character could be played, and it earned him some major awards, too, which is quite an achievement.

Then there’s "The Conversation," a film that’s a bit more subtle but just as powerful. In this one, he played a surveillance expert, and his performance was full of quiet anxiety and deep thought. It really showed his ability to carry a complex story with a lot of inner turmoil, proving he wasn't just good at playing tough guys. This movie, you know, is often cited as one of his very best, demonstrating a different side to his acting prowess. It's a rather chilling look at privacy and paranoia, and he's just superb in it.

"Unforgiven" is another one that truly stands out, a Western that turned many classic ideas on their head. In this film, he played a very different kind of character, a sheriff who was both menacing and, in a strange way, quite human. His performance here was so compelling that it brought him another big award, cementing his place as one of the finest actors of his generation. It's almost as if he could do no wrong, consistently delivering performances that were both powerful and deeply nuanced, adding to the rich collection of Gene Hackman movies we have.

And we can't forget "The Royal Tenenbaums," a much lighter but equally memorable film. Here, he showed his comedic timing and his ability to play a character who was both flawed and charming. It was a pleasant surprise for many to see him in such a different kind of role, and he absolutely nailed it. This movie, actually, proved that his range was even wider than people might have thought, allowing him to be both dramatic and genuinely funny, which is a rare gift for an actor. It just goes to show how versatile he truly was.
